Now the construction industry has developed rapidly. When it improves the living environment, it has been increasing energy consumption at the same time. With the total energy consumption is rising year by year, the most energy consumption is from the air conditioning unit in the heating system. It is more than about ninety percent of the whole building energy consumption, and it is more than twenty percent of the total energy consumption in the whole society. Such a huge energy consumption, it is not only accelerates the energy crisis, but also leads to the waste of resources and environmental pollution. So it is very necessary to reduce the energy consumption of the construction industry, especially the energy consumption of the heating ventilation air conditioning. And it is very necessary to take appropriate controlling strategies to raise the level of the automatic control of air conditioning, realize the energy saving.Take the heating ventilation air conditioning unit in the plant as the researching object, analyses the possible factor that it causes the energy consumption of the air conditioning unit very largely. Thus it is concluded that the level of automation control system in air conditioning unit and the efficiency is low, the energy consumption is large. And put forward the subject that research and develop the air conditioning unit controlling system based on PLC technology. This paper introduces the controlling process of the heating ventilation air conditioning system in the factory in detail. It expounds the working principle of the air conditioner in each process and controlling method of the main equipment. According to the actual situation of the factory and the second law of thermodynamics, we established the mathematical model of temperature and humidity of the air conditioning system. Based on the mathematical model, we established the mathematical expression of the temperature and humidity, accomplish designing the PID controller of the air conditioning unit.By combining the PLC with the PLC and PID control technology, we completed the whole hardware system design of the control system of the air conditioning unit.Based on the equipment of AB company Control Logix series PLC, we design a set of practical, safe, reliable, economic, air conditioning automatic control system, by using mathematical model, PLC control technology and PID controlling method. Based on Windows XP system operation platform, we use the Factory view studio software to build an air conditioning automatic controlling project, including engineers station, monitoring system images, and alarm trend log.The air conditioning unit control system optimizes the control of the operation of air conditioning unit. It can dynamically detect and track the air conditioning load, so it realizes the real-time control of air conditioning unit operation. It effectively solves the problem that under the complex load changing the air conditioning unit adjustment ability is poor. So it improves the efficiency of air conditioning unit and the energy efficiency when the working condition is complex and achieves the best energy-saving effect.
